Online resources: Summary: Meant for marine, atmospheric, and industrial chemists, this book examines aquatic pollutants through a holistic approach. With sections highlighting air-water processes; water column processes; water-sediment processes; and case studies, it emphasizes the chemical and physical processes controlling solute behavior and fate in air and water.
